Phenyl silicone rubber, with its unique physicochemical properties, demonstrates extensive application potential in multiple fields. This high-performance material not only resists high temperatures but also exhibits excellent electrical insulation and low-temperature resistance, maintaining stable operating conditions under various extreme conditions.
In the automotive manufacturing industry, phenyl silicone rubber is widely used in the production of sealing materials, rubber tubes, and rubber parts. Its outstanding high-temperature resistance and aging resistance ensure the long-term reliability of automotive components. In the aerospace field, phenyl silicone rubber is used for high-temperature seals, hydraulic seals, and rubber tubes, meeting the high requirements for material performance in aerospace devices.
In the electronics and electrical appliances sector, the high electrical insulation and low-temperature resistance of phenyl silicone rubber make it an ideal material for manufacturing high-temperature cables, cable protection tubes, and electrical insulating components. Additionally, in medical devices, phenyl silicone rubber is used for seals and tubing, ensuring the stability and safety of medical equipment.
